Warranty Policy—Overview

Electraletter warrants its new, factory certified products and its parts against defects in material during the specified warranty period. During this period, Electraletter will, at its sole option, repair or replace a defective product or part without charge to you. This excludes shipping or installation, field support labor or loss of profit, incoming or revenue.

Electraletter warrants all our sold brands products, including LED modules, LED sign and power supply which you have purchased directly from Electraletter to be free from defects in materials under normal use during the warranty period. The customer will process warranty service with Electraletter’s distributor if they purchased from them.

This limited warranty covers normal usage only. Electraletter does not warrant and is not responsible for damages caused by misuse, abuse, accidents, viruses, unauthorized service or parts, or the combination of Electraletter branded products with other products. This limited warranty does not cover software.

Warranty Policy—LED Modules And Power Supply

LED Modules and power supplies are warranted to be free from defect for a period of three (3) years from the date of their original purchase.

This limited warranty is valid only when the LED products and power supply used together.

During the warranty period, Electraletter will repair or replace defective parts with new or, at Electraletter option, serviceable used parts that are equivalent to new parts in performance. All exchanged parts and products replaced under this warranty will become the property of Electraletter This warranty does not apply any others involved installation, remove or replacement caused by LED Modules.

RMA Policy

DOA (Dead On Arrival) Product:

Customer shall request DOA merchandise to be replaced within 5 days from the date of the original invoice. Customer must request an RMA (Return Material Authorization) number for the DOA Product within 5 days from the date of the corresponding issued invoice.

Regular RMA (In-Warranty Products):

This provision excludes products, which defects are caused by customer and/or carrier’s mishandling. The following described products are excluded from repair service, and are advised not to be sent back to Electraletter for repair as they are deemed not repairable. Products found bent, corroded, deformed, mildewed, broken, rusted, scratched PC board surface or of similar conditions.

RMA Return Procedures

  • Customer shall email the detail information of defective products to sales@electraletter.com Or call your sale representative.
  • The information should include returned quantity, model# problem description and your contact information.

Return For Credit

  • From the Electraletter where the product brought
  • Within 7 days from the invoice date
  • Subject to a 15% restocking fee
  • Must pay all shipping costs and ship back first
  • A RMA number will be issued to customer prior to return

Damages

All damages must be reported and noted on the bill of landing same day product is received, and faxed to us immediately in order to properly file a claim report. Otherwise, Customer is responsible for all incurred repair costs, which may include: labor, parts, and all related shipping charges.

Electraletter retains the right to assess all warranty claims and to determine if damages are covered by the warranty. In case of a claim that is not covered by the warranty, you will be contacted to determine whether Electraletter should repair the damage for a fee or whether the product should be returned to you as received by Electraletter.
